ITEM 6: CANNABIS CONDITIONAL USE PERMIT & VARIANCE (P-18-23) A request for approval to expand an existing Type 2' "Small Outdoor" commercial cannabis cultivation license, permitted by Trinity County since 2016 into a Type 3"Medium Outdoor" commercial cannabis cultivation license to allow for up to 43,560 square feet(1 acre) of mature canopy split between the two properties as well as convert a Type 13 Transport-Only" license, under identical ownershiplicensure, into a Type 11 "Distribution" license for up to 500 square feet; in addition, the applicant is applying to add a Type 4 commercial "Nursery" license, which would include the sale of immature cannabis plants, seeds and auxiliary sales to licensed cultivators and retailers. The applicant has also applied for a variance concurrently with the CUP from the limitations of location, to site the cultivation area less than five hundred (500) feet from the adjacent property lines. The Project is located on two adjacent 40- acre parcels located in the unincorporated community of Peanut, in Trinity County. Assessor's Parcel Number 019-750-013 (Parcel 1) is located at 341 Rattlesnake Rd, and 019-750-017 (Parcel 2) is located at 140 State Highway 3 in Peanut, Public comment received from Rod Patton-Applicant, Scott Watkins-Hayfork.
